EDITORIAL USE ONLY Artist Hanna Benihoud with her installation ‘What Blooms Beneath’, on display across Borough Yards in London. Picture date: Wednesday May 6, 2026. PA Photo. Featuring sculptural works made from crin, a mesh-like fabric, the installation winds through the area to form a loose trail, encouraging visitors to follow the route, running from May to July.
